2. Hyperautomation – automating and evolving a company’s processes


Automation was a key-driver of industrialisation in the past, transforming production processes significantly. Jobs that were done by humans prior to that, are now automated and performed by machines. This trend is likely to experience a renaissance. Thanks to AI support, automation will become relevant once again. Gartner calls this new trend hyperautomation: the increased use of AI in combination with machine learning (ML) and Robotic Process Automation (RPA) will give rise to a variety of processes1. Thanks to Konica Minolta’s experience in this field, the IT specialist is able to automate processes in all departments of a company – from invoice processing to inventory management. The impact is measurable almost immediately, as more tasks can be handled at the same time, errors occur less often or disappear completely, and employees’ workloads are eased. In the future, hyperautomation will be able to create a DTO (digital twin of the organisation) that reflects the entire company and every process digitally1. The benefit created cannot be overestimated: having a digital replica empowers the company to analyse, evaluate and improve its processes accordingly.


3. Analytics – data usage and forecasting for optimal efficiency

Analytics help to evaluate and challenge current processes, improving efficiency by analysing current and predicted data. 2020 will come one step closer to the combination of predictive and descriptive analytics: prescriptive analytics. Many companies still use descriptive analytics, focusing on what happened and base their strategy on that, while others predict future developments to drive their businesses – predictive analytics. Prescriptive analytics combines both approaches and evolves them: it predicts the future and justifies the predictions based on descriptive analytics. Incoming data can easily be integrated, too, and adjust the predictions accordingly3. Improved analytics and the real-time processing of data will lead to analytics as a competitive advantage, as Forbes4 forecasts. Business decisions can therefore be based on reliable sources and analysis, offering an optimal basis for the future. 7. Blockchain – the basis for IT improvements in the 2020s

2019 saw a great deal of hype about Bitcoin and cryptocurrencies. Blockchain technology is the basis for cryptocurrencies generally and is expected to dominate the market next year, while the scope of its use will split. One main field will be smart contracts. A blockchain provides a secure basis when signing contracts, as the underlying technology provides a permanent base that cannot be changed. It is also unaffected by the volume or regional concentration of contracts. Escrow agreements in particular benefit from blockchain technology – securing and automating their handling. Another field will be safeguarding assets digitally. On the one hand, a blockchain allows important and crucial data to be integrated and stored. On the other hand, only a specific group of employees can access them, which is especially appropriate in the banking or the medical sector. Additionally, many people are able to access the same database, while access rights are tiered. The supply chain for food products can also benefit from this system6. The “classic” application of blockchain technology in providing the basis for cryptocurrencies may be revitalised, too. Facebook aims to launch its own cryptocurrency in 2020, making it more likely for new hype around cryptocurrencies to continue next year
